/*! sprintf.js | Copyright (c) 2007-2013 Alexandru Marasteanu | 3 clause BSD license */(function(e){function r(e){return Object.prototype.toString.call(e).slice(8,-1).toLowerCase()}function i(e,t){for(var n=[];t>0;n[--t]=e);return n.join("")}var t=function(){return t.cache.hasOwnProperty(arguments[0])||(t.cache[arguments[0]]=t.parse(arguments[0])),t.format.call(null,t.cache[arguments[0]],arguments)};t.format=function(e,n){var s=1,o=e.length,u="",a,f=[],l,c,h,p,d,v;for(l=0;l>>=0;break;case"x":a=a.toString(16);break;case"X":a=a.toString(16).toUpperCase()}a=/[def]/.test(h[8])&&h[3]&&a>=0?"+"+a:a,d=h[4]?h[4]=="0"?"0":h[4].charAt(1):" ",v=h[6]-String(a).length,p=h[6]?i(d,v):"",f.push(h[5]?a+p:p+a)}}return f.join("")},t.cache={},t.parse=function(e){var t=e,n=[],r=[],i=0;while(t){if((n=/^[^%]+/.exec(t))!==null)r.push(n[0]);else if((n=/^%{2}/.exec(t))!==null)r.push("%");else{if((n=/^%(?:([1-9]\d*)$|\(([^\)]+)\))?(\+)?(0|'[^$])?(-)?(\d+)?(?:\.(\d+))?([b-fosuxX])/.exec(t))===null)throw"[sprintf] huh?";if(n[2]){i|=1;var s=[],o=n[2],u=[];if((u=/^([a-z_][a-z_\d]*)/i.exec(o))===null)throw"[sprintf] huh?";s.push(u[1]);while((o=o.substring(u[0].length))!=="")if((u=/^\.([a-z_][a-z_\d]*)/i.exec(o))!==null)s.push(u[1]);else{if((u=/^\[(\d+)\]/.exec(o))===null)throw"[sprintf] huh?";s.push(u[1])}n[2]=s}else i|=2;if(i===3)throw"[sprintf] mixing positional and named placeholders is not (yet) supported";r.push(n)}t=t.substring(n[0].length)}return r};var n=function(e,n,r){return r=n.slice(0),r.splice(0,0,e),t.apply(null,r)};e.sprintf=t,e.vsprintf=n})(typeof exports!="undefined"?exports:window); $L = function(){ var rtn = ""; var data = {"hp_mnu_buyers":"Buyers","hp_mnu_sellers":"Sellers","hp_mnu_blog":"Blog","bg_title":"Schools In Your Area","bg_sub":"Research the top schools in your future neighborhood.","property_search":"Home Search","Pets":"Pets","Water":"Water","Penthouse":"Penthouse","MiscOptions":"Misc Options","NotApplicable":"n\/a","DetailsCredits":"Listing courtesy of %s","DetailsDisclaimer":"The listings on this site originate from the %s MLS and are provided for personal, non-commercial use. Data may not be used for any other purpose than to identify properties consumers may be interested in purchasing. Real estate listings that are held by firms other than the office owning this website are labeled. The data provided herein is considered true and reliable but is not guaranteed.","fbook_demo_id":"Your are using a DEMO<\/b> version of the iAgentWeb Home Search App<\/b>. In order to get the proper functionality you must link to your iAgentWeb Account<\/b>. Please click on the following link to complete installation: %s","fbook_demo_user":"This is a DEMO<\/b> version of the iAgentWeb Home Search App<\/b>. If you are the owner of this page log in to your Facebook<\/b> account for instructions on activating the app.","account_inactive":"This account has been deactivated by the owner.","account_expired":"The subscription for this account has expired.","account_not_idx":"You need to upgrade your subscription to enable IDX functions.","account_not_verified":"The MLS service for this account has not been verified yet. Although it should be sooner this may take up to 24 hours.","account_site_not_allowed":"You have not selected the Website Option<\/b> for your subscription. If you would like this option please update you subscription.","account_map_not_allowed":"You have not selected the Plugin Option<\/b> for your subscription. If you would like this option please update you subscription.","account_facebook_not_allowed":"You have not selected the Facebook App Option<\/b> for your subscription. If you would like this option please update you subscription.","account_no_mls":"You have not selected an MLS for this map. Please log in to your account and specify an MLS.","hp_need_login_fbook":"In order to %s you need to login to your Facebook account or if you don't have an account, you need to create one.","hp_need_login_fbook_demo":"You are using a demo version of iAgentWeb Property Search. This feature does not work in the demo version.","link_account":"Link to iAgentWeb Account<\/b>","map_demo_id":"Your are using a demo API Key<\/b> or an invalid one. In order to get the proper functionality you must obtain a valid API Key<\/b> and enter it in the iAgentWeb Plugin Code<\/b> of your application. Get API Key...<\/a>","map_demo_id_wp":"Your are using a demo API Key<\/b> or an invalid one. In order to get the proper functionality you must obtain a valid API Key<\/b> and enter it in the iAgentWeb Settings - API Key<\/b> field of your Wordpress<\/b> application. Get API Key...<\/a>","map_demo_mode_url":"You must set your Auth. Domain<\/b> to %s<\/b> in your iAgentWeb Account<\/b> to get full functionality providing you have the proper subscription. Set Auth Domain...<\/a>","SaleType":"Sale Type","AllSaleTypes":"All Sale Types","RegularSale":"Regular Sale","Foreclosure":"Foreclosure","ShortSale":"Short Sale","ForeclosureAndShortSale":"Foreclosure And Short Sale","AnySqft":"Any SqFt","AnyYear":"Any Year","PropertyType":"Property Type","MoreFilters":"More Filters","ResetAll":"Reset All","AllPropertyTypes":"All Property Types","SingleFamily":"Single Family","MobileHome":"Mobile Home","AptCondoTownHouse":"Apt\/Condo\/TownHouse","brw_01":"Did you know this version of your browser does not support some advanced features used by iAgentWeb?","brw_02":"To get the best experience using iAgentWeb we recommend that you upgrade to the latest version of your browser. Below is a list of the most popular browsers.","brw_03":"Just click on one of the icons below to go to that browsers download page.","brw_04":"Or click here to continue without upgrading.","mmLinkDisabled":"This item is disabled in design mode. Please switch to Preview<\/b> mode for testing website functionality.","g_ws_title":"iAgentWeb - Real Estate Websites","map_email_tag":"Email: %s","map_phone_tag":"Phone: %s","map_mnu_login":"Log In","map_mnu_signup":"Sign Up","map_mnu_logout":"Log Out","enter_password":"Enter new password below","hp_listings_attached":"%s Listing(s) Attached","hp_twit_msg":"Check out this %s home at %s, I found on %s","hp_subject_msg":"%s found this home on %s and wanted to share it with you.","hp_friend_msg":"A friend","hp_btn_ok":"OK","hp_btn_cancel":"Cancel","hp_btn_yes":"Yes","hp_btn_no":"No","hp_one_email":"Only one email address allowed.","hp_email_favorites":"E-Mail Favorites","hp_no_favs_sel":"Please select at least one listing to include in email.","hp_bad_save_favorites":"Error saving favorites.","hp_cancel_spinner":"Are you sure you want to cancel the current operation?","hp_no_favorites":"You have no properties saved in favorites.","hp_save":"Save","hp_login":"Log In","hp_logout":"Log Out","hp_signup":"Sign Up","hp_remember_me":"Remember Me","hp_forgot_pwd":"Forgot Password","hp_error":"Error","hp_bad_login":"Login failed! Invalid email or password entered. Please try again.","hp_recover_pwd":"Recover Password","hp_recover_email":"Enter email to recover password.","hp_recover_bad_email":"Email address %s was not found.","hp_recover_good_email":"An email has been sent to %s with a link to recover your account password.","hp_mnu_home":"Home","hp_mnu_map":"Map","hp_mnu_listings":"Listings","hp_mnu_about":"About","hp_mnu_contact":"Contact","hp_mnu_settings":"Settings","hp_mnu_more":"More","hp_mnu_favorites":"Favorites","hp_mnu_favorites_short":"Favs","hp_mnu_prop_details":"Property Details","hp_mnu_profile":"Profile","hp_mnu_news":"News","hp_head_featured_listings":"Suggested Properties","hp_head_contact_us":"Contact Us","hp_sub_head_contact_us":"Use the form below to request free information or to have your questions answered.","hp_need_login":"In order to %s you need to login to your account or if you don't have an acount, you can create one for free. Click OK to go there now.","hp_save_favs":"view\/save favorites","hp_send_det":"send emails ","hp_save_prof":"view\/save profile settings","hp_msg_freind":"I wanted to share some great listings I found on %s. Check them out and let me know what you think.","hp_msg_agent":"I would like more information on these listings. Please contact me as soon as possible.","hp_msg_msg_txt_count":"","hp_all_homes":"All Homes","hp_for_sale":"For Sale","hp_for_rent":"For Rent","hp_about":"About","hp_office":"Office","hp_toggle_nav":"Toggle navigation","hp_send_msg":"Send Message","hp_to_email":"Recipient's Email","hp_ph_form_name":"Your Name *","hp_ph_form_email":"Your Email *","hp_ph_form_phone":"Your Phone *","hp_ph_form_msg":"Your Message *","hp_form_addr":"Address","hp_form_email":"Email","hp_form_message":"Message","hp_form_phone":"Phone","hp_form_map":"Map","hp_form_get_directions":"Click to get directions...","hp_form_follow":"Follow","save":"Save","fname":"First Name","lname":"Last Name","email":"E-Mail","telephone":"Telephone","password":"Password","cpassword":"Confirm Password","typchars":"Type the characters above...","cb_blank":"cannot be blank.","password_match":"Passwords do not match.","bad_passwword":"Please enter a password that is between 6 and 20 characters long.","captcha_code_blank":"Captcha code cannot be blank. Please type in the captcha characters.","captcha_code_bad":"Captcha code did not match. Please try again.","profile_updated":"Profile information updated.","bad_email":"Please enter a valid email address.","bad_email_ex":"Please enter a valid email address. Only one email address is allowed.","i_accept":"I accept the","tos":"Terms of Use","tos_no_check":"You must agree with the Terms of Use. Please check the TOS box to continue.","signup_success":"Sign up successful. Please log in to continue.","email_exists_part":"An account already exists with this email. Please check the spelling or go to the login screen to recover your password.","email_exists":"An account already exists with this email. Please check the spelling or enter a valid email.","password_saved":"Password Saved. Please log in to continue.","password_saved_err":"Password could not be saved. Please try again.","hp_err_form_fill":"Please make sure the form is filled correctly.","hp_err_form_name":"Please enter your name.","hp_err_form_email":"Please enter your email address.","hp_err_form_phone":"Please enter your phone number.","hp_err_form_msg":"Please enter a message.","hp_err_captcha":"Please enter the code above.","hp_err_form_fail":"Sorry, it seems that our mail server is not responding. Please try again.","hp_conf_form_sent":"Your message has been sent.","hp_copyright":"Copyright","hp_privacy_policy":"Privacy Policy","hp_terms_of_use":"Terms of Use","hp_sent_to":"Send To","hp_sent_to_agent":"Send To Agent","hp_send":"Send","hp_or":"or","hp_share_listing":"Share Listing","Currency":"$","ShortYes":"Y","ShortNo":"N","LongYes":"Yes","LongNo":"No","btn_menu_filters_lbl":"Search & Filters","btn_menu_tools_lbl":"Search Tools","btn_zone_srch_lbl":"Area Search","btn_sat_view_sat_lbl":"Satellite","btn_sat_view_rmap_lbl":"Road Map","Beds-small":"bd","Baths-small":"ba","Beds":"Beds","Baths":"Baths","Pool":"Pool","SqFt":"SqFt","SqFtl":"sqft","Commercial":"Commercial","ForSaleShort":"S","ForRentShort":"R","CommercialShort":"C","Remarks":"Remarks","General":"General","Interior":"Interior","Ameneties":"Amenities","NoFeature":"This feature is not available now.","Parking":"Parking","MLS#":"MLS#","BuiltIn":"Built in","PSqFt":"Price\/Sqft","DaysMarket":"Days on market","List":"List","Area":"Area","Details":"Details","HomeSearch":"Home Search","ForSaleMin":"Sale","ForRentMin":"Rent","ForSale":"For Sale","ForRent":"For Rent","Sold":"Sold","Rented":"Rented","PendingSale":"Pending Sale","NotAvailable":"Not Available","Cancelled":"Cancelled","All":"All","MyStuff":"MyStuff","SavedListings":"Saved Listings","SavedSearches":"Saved Searches","Account":"Account","Settings":"Settings","Search":"Search","AreaSearch":"Area Search","AroundMe":"Around Me","Price":"Price","AnyPrice":"Any Price","Any":"Any","UpTo":"Up To","OrMore":"Or More","To":"To","Apply":"Apply","Cancel":"Cancel","Close":"Close","Pictures":"Pictures","Map":"Map","MapSettings":"Map Settings","AccountSettings":"Account Settings","RoadMap":"Road Map","Satellite":"Satellite","of":"of","Filters":"Filters","Sorting":"Sorting","LowToHigh":"Low To High","HighToLow":"High To Low","SquareFeet":"Square Feet","YearBuilt":"Year Built","DaysOnMarket":"Days On Market","LastUpdate":"Last Update","OpenNow":"Open now","Rating":"Rating","PriceLevel":"Price level","BirdsEye":"Aerial","Street":"Street","Places":"Places","PlacesMenu":"Places Menu","Schools":"Schools","SchoolsPlus":"Schools+","Restaurants":"Restaurants","Banks":"Banks","CoffeeShops":"Coffee Shops","Bar":"Bar","Home":"Home","btn_srch_msg":"City, MLS Id(s) or Zip(s)","btn_srch_none":"Your search did not return any matches. Please specify a City, MLS Id or Zip Code. \r\n\r\nYou may specify multiple MLS Ids or Zips by separating them with a comma. e.g. 33331, 33332, 33333, For a street address type in the first part of the address. e.g type 2356 for 2356 Anchor Lane. The results will be a short list of addresses that match that number. \r\n\r\nYou may also specify an area using the Search Tools menu or you may want to revise your filters settings.","btn_srch_out_of_mem":"Your search returned too many results. Please refine your search and try again.","btn_srch_erorr":"An error occurred in your search.","click_to_zoom_in":"Click on icon to zoom in...","click_for_details":"Click on icon for more details...","tt_zone_srch":"Search Tools","tt_menu_filters":"Search, Filter, Sort Menu","tt_sat_view":"Toggle Map View","tt_search":"Search","tt_menu_main":"Main Menu","tt_map_previews":"Properties list","tt_map_history":"Go back","tt_map_favorites":"View favorites","tt_map_favorites_send":"Email selected listings","tt_map_favorites_select_all":"Select all","tt_map_favorites_select_none":"Select none","tt_map_favs_detail_zoom":"Zoom Image","tt_map_favorites_add":"Add to favorites","tt_fav_select":"Select Property","tt_map_home":"Back to map","tt_map_favs_detail_share":"Share listing","hp_license":"Buy Image License"} if(arguments.length==0) rtn = data; if(arguments.length==1) rtn = data[arguments[0]]; if(arguments.length>1){ var args = Array.prototype.slice.call(arguments); rtn = vsprintf(data[args[0]],args.slice(1)); } return rtn; };